#d72738 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d72738 is composed of 84.3% red, 15.3%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.9% magenta, 74%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 354.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.3% and a lightness of 49.8%. #d72738 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4e70 with #af0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#d72738

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100304 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d72738

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7f7f is the less saturated color, while #f40a20 is the most saturated one.
